I mentioned this restaurant briefly earlier on today and Portofan is right, there's very little said about it but when we last visited in 1996 we found it a lovely place to eat.
Has anyone eaten there recently?
It is in Carrer El Cano, just off the main road into PP (on the right hand side as you come along the road).
When we went there it was Swiss-owned (I think) and the menu was dominated by red cabbage and lots of meat.
Back in May we took a look at the menu and it didn't seem to have changed a lot, but after 9 years I would be more than ready to sample it again!
There is no outside eating area but I remember it was always busy and the food was good and plentiful.
Any more comments would be welcome because we would like to re-visit in a couple of weeks time.
